Adelaide Hills painting, done properly
Standard acrylic paint doesn't last in the Hills. The temperature swing stresses the paint film. Contraction in winter, expansion in summer, repeat for years. Cracks develop, moisture gets behind, and the paint lets go.
We spec elastomeric coatings rated for -5°C to 50°C on Hills exteriors. They stretch with the substrate. Bridge hairline cracks. Shrug off UV. 10-15 year life versus 3-5 for standard exterior acrylic in the same conditions.
On north elevations we add UV-resistant top glaze. On south and shaded walls we add anti-mould treatment. On bushfire-zone properties we spec fire-retardant primers and paint-over fire-retardant coatings as required.
